Gran, 84, who married Egyptian toyboy, 37, issues dating site warning

An 84-year-old grandmother who married an Egyptian man 46 years younger than her has issued a warning about entering into romantic relationships online.

Iris Jones hit headlines when she appeared on ITV's This Morning to discuss her relationship with 37-year-old Mohamed Ibriham. The pair met on Facebook before Iris jetted out to Egypt to marry him in November 2020.

But by last year, the two had separated. At the time she told Closer magazine: "I never expected to fall in love with someone 46 years younger than me, but I did. I adored everything about Mohamed".

She said everything was great before the relationship broke down due to constant arguments, the Liverpool ECHO reports.

Now, in a new Facebook post, Iris has issued a stark warning to anyone who uses dating websites. She said: "A warning to all vulnerable women online, chatting to scammers and con-artists, thinking they are messaging genuine males on legitimate dating sites.

"Be aware that they are only interested in getting their filthy paws on your money and will sweet-talk you for weeks, or even months in order to achieve their goal. I, myself, have been targeted by four scammers in the last few months and regard myself now as a competent scam hunter!"

Iris went on to say she had sent a "final email" to the scammer who she claimed had been trying to con her out of thousands of pounds. She added: "I have really enjoyed being the puppet master, having you dance to my tune. It only remains for me to say that I am delighted that you exited my life EMPTY-HANDED!!!! Tootle-pip, sunshine."
